Search results for "Barbara Keegan"
Hide in the Light (2018)

Hide in the Light (2018)

Hide in the Light (2018)
IMDb: N/A
78

An adventurous group of friends dare to break into the abandoned orphanage and quickly find themselves trapped and fighting against unnatural forces.

Barracuda (1978)

Barracuda (1978)

Barracuda (1978)
IMDb: N/A
98

Little coastal town is being terrorized by deadly Barracudas.

Genre: Horror, Thriller